Leading award season make-up artists to follow for year-round inspiration

Great make-up is not just for award season.


And breathe. Award season, the Super Bowl, the 2020 general election – it’s all over.

We’re at the height of fashion month so you don’t have to wait too long to catch a celebrity look glamorous – we will be continuing to cover every great look and gorgeous eyeliner to hit a red carpet or runway. In the meantime, if you’re mourning the vacuous thrill of seeing a celebrity looking their best, meet their leading make-up artists. They’re here all year round creating incredible, trend-setting beauty looks that make you think, “huh, maybe I could swap my everyday brown eyeshadow for a little graphic pink eyeliner detail.”

Take Jo Baker, for example. If you’re interested in the make-up artists who create incredible award seasons beauty, chances are you already know Jo Baker. Her work with Lucy Boynton has singlehandedly raised our red carpet beauty expectations – we don’t want a classic red lip anymore! We want eyes embellished with the sequins of your dress! Jo Baker’s Instagram is filled with her inspirations of everything from fish to bugs to high vis vests and every look she creates makes you want to revisit your beauty look, whether it’s sunshine yellow eyeshadow, graphic eyeliner or spikey, clumpy mascara.

Scroll on down for the leading celebrity make-up artists whose pages we’ve been refreshing all 2020…
